Sports Mole previews Saturday's Championship clash between Huddersfield Town and Sheffield United, including predictions, team news and possible lineups.

We said: Huddersfield Town 1-2 Sheffield United

A derby between two in-form teams throws up all kinds of possibilities, and we can see nothing but a competitive encounter playing out in Yorkshire. Nevertheless, the Blades have the greater momentum, something which could help them push for all three points during the closing stages. Read more.

Data Analysis

Our analysis of all available data, including recent performances and player stats up until an hour before kickoff, suggested the most likely outcome of this match was a Sheffield United win with a probability of 38.98%. A win for Huddersfield Town had a probability of 33.23% and a draw had a probability of 27.8%.

The most likely scoreline for a Sheffield United win was 0-1 with a probability of 11.61%. The next most likely scorelines for that outcome were 1-2 (8.15%) and 0-2 (7.23%). The likeliest Huddersfield Town win was 1-0 (10.51%), while for a drawn scoreline it was 1-1 (13.09%). The actual scoreline of 0-0 was predicted with a 9.3% likelihood.
